Web2 years ago. Hello, @Rick1981, Thank you for reaching out. If the SIM card is compatible between the devices, there shouldn't be any issues just swapping it out. You may need to change the iPhone's APN settings to use some data services, but as long as each device uses the same size SIM card, you should be fine. Have a great week. WebTo add your mobile network plan on an eSIM, you can scan a QR code that your network has provided, install a pre-assigned plan automatically, or enter the information manually. Before adding your plan, make sure your Galaxy smartphone is connected to WiFi or mobile data network. Install a pre-assigned plan. Scan a QR code.

WebA SIM card lives inside your cell phone and is essentially your phone’s ID. It stores contacts and other data, and your phone won’t work without it. A SIM card works by connecting with your mobile phone and your carrier’s cell towers, so the two can communicate.
